CONFAB 2025 Juror Statement

The amount of talent, vulnerability, and breadth of skill I encountered while looking through this year’s submissions was staggering. The stories being communicated and the full spectrum of imagination I witnessed was overwhelming. The selections for this show speak not only to the theme of confabulation but also reflect where I stand right now as an arts professional living in Washington DC.

This show captures the tension of our current moment—the disorienting political chaos and systematic targeting of historically underrepresented identities and narratives, contrasted with the undeniable power people still wield through their voices and actions. There is darkness and anger, but also profound beauty in this moment of people coming together and still finding meaning in the world around them. There's also considerable absurdity happening right now, which I wanted to reflect as well.

I aimed to devise a show that explores the power of different formats and mediums to express ideas about identity, the environment, and history. Lastly, I want people to remember where we came from, where we are, and what possibilities exist for the future. While it's difficult to maintain hope right now, these artists demonstrate that art has been and will continue to be a vessel for communicating our complex emotions as we try to make sense of what's happening and how to move forward.

- Ashleigh D. Coren, CONFAB 2025 Juror
